1: \begin{abstract}
2: Real-world network applications must cope with failing nodes,
3: malicious attacks, or, somehow, nodes facing corrupted data ---
4: classified as outliers. One enabling application is the geographic
5: localization of the network nodes. However, despite excellent work
6: on the network localization problem, prior research seldom
7: considered outlier data --- even now, when already deployed networks
8: cry out for robust procedures. We propose robust, fast, and
9: distributed network localization algorithms, resilient to high-power
10: noise, but also precise under regular Gaussian noise. We use the
11: Huber M-estimator as a difference measure between the distance of
12: estimated nodes and noisy range measurements, thus obtaining a
13: robust (but nonconvex) optimization problem. We then devise a convex
14: underestimator solvable in polynomial time, and tight in the
15: inter-node terms. We also provide an optimality bound for the convex
16: underestimator. We put forward a new representation of the Huber
17: function composed with a norm, enabling distributed robust
18: localization algorithms to minimize the proposed underestimator. The
19: synchronous distributed method has optimal convergence rate and the
20: asynchronous one converges in finite time, for a given
21: precision. The main highlight of our contribution lies on the fact
22: that we pay no price for distributed computation nor in accuracy,
23: nor in communication cost or convergence speed. Simulations show the
24: advantage of using our proposed algorithms, both in the presence of
25: outliers and under regular Gaussian noise: our method exceeds the
26: accuracy of an alternative robust approach based on L1 norms by at
27: least 100m in an area of 1Km sides.
28: \end{abstract}
29: